    Default Re: Beatles or Stones?

    Quote Originally Posted by Lyle View Post
    The Stones were waaaaaay more versitlie as a band, The Beatles were great but only branched out near the end and then as individual acts.
    Absolutely wrong Lyle
    The Beatles played folk,big band swing,spirituals,psychedelia,straight rock n roll,country and western,et all
    The Beatles used more and more complex instrumentation when noone else was.
    I like early Stones,but no way on earth were they more versatile
    Elanor Rigby
    Your Mother Should Know
    A Day In A Life
    Act Naturally
    Let It Be
    Norweigan wood
    vs
    Satisfaction
    Sympathy For The Devil
    Brown Sugar
    I wanna be your man(written by Lennon/McCartney)
    Lets Spend The Night Together
    The Last Time

    I like the Stones before Jones snuffed it,but it isnt even close,as far as versatility
